  • Patent number: 6673094
    Abstract: A system and method is disclosed for attaching tissue to bone. The system comprises an expander pin configured to receive suture; an expandable body configured to receive the expander pin; the expander pin expanding the expandable body when the expander pin is received in the expandable body; the expander pin and the expandable body being configured to (1) allow sliding movement of the suture relative to the expander pin when the expander pin is disposed in a first position relative to the expandable body, and (2) bind the suture relative to the expander pin when the expander pin is disposed in a second position relative to the expandable body; an installation tool adapted to releaseably attach to the expandable body; and the installation tool including a pusher for driving the expander pin into the expandable body.

  • Patent number: 6319252
    Abstract: Apparatus and methods are disclosed for attaching tissue to bone. Apparatus is disclosed for assembling tissue to bone comprising an expandable body configured to expand into bone, the expandable body defining a bore; and an expander pin comprising a shaft sized to be received in the bore of the expandable body and expand the expandable body laterally when the expander pin is driven into the expandable body, and tissue attachment apparatus associated with the shaft, the expander pin defining a bore; whereby when the expander pin is driven into the expandable body, the expandable will be attached to bone and the tissue attachment apparatus will secure tissue to the apparatus. A method is disclosed for attaching tissue to bone comprising driving an expandable body into a bone, the expandable body defining a bore and comprising tissue attachment apparatus; and fixing the expandable body in, and thereby securing the tissue to relative to, the bone.

  • Patent number: 5935129
    Abstract: The invention provides anchoring devices and methods for coupling an object, such as a suture or soft tissue, to bone. In one aspect of the invention, a bone anchor is placed into compression fit with a predrilled bone hole by pulling an insertion stem at least partially into an anchoring element. In its non-expanded state, the anchoring element is slidably mounted on the proximal end of the insertion stem. The anchoring element has an axial channel at least a portion of which has an inner diameter (or cross-section) smaller than an outer diameter (or cross-section) of at least one portion of the insertion stem. As that larger portion of the insertion stem is pulled through the channel, it causes the walls of the anchoring element to expand outwardly and, thereby, to engage the bone hole walls in a pressure or compression fit.
